Why does your organisation need a robust Whistle Blowing Facility?

The most common method of detecting fraud or breaches of integrity within an organisation is by tip-off's. These are a major source to identify and eliminate wrong doing. Whilst you may have excellent internal reporting systems, on occasions, personnel may feel uncomfortable using them. It is recognised that an independent external provider can overcome employee's concerns. Which may include;

  • Lack of organisational support.
  • Fear that nothing will happen and they may not be taken seriously.
  • Recent surveys indicate that a large proportion of staff feel they couldn't safely report misconduct within their organisation.
  • Lack of anonymity.
  • They face difficult choices to come forward with a fear of reprisals.
  • Inadequate or inappropriate internal reporting procedures.

We provide an independent service for relevant persons to report concerns, including those that do not wish to disclose their identity.

Detecting fraud saves money and reduces the possibilities of reputational damage.

Robust Fraud Prevention procedures help increase the confidence of investors, partners and others connected with your business.

To demonstrate your organisation is committed to preventing bribery & corruption and therefore increase the likelihood of a successful defence if faced with prosecution under the Bribery Act 2010 for 'failing to prevent bribery'.

Many organisations have a Whistle Blowing hotline but this is often manned by individuals known to the Whistle Blower, In general these types of hotlines are rarely used.

Protection for Whistle Blowers

The Public Disclosure Act 1998 allows employees to voice concerns in good faith about misconduct and malpractice without receiving penalties such as dismissal, victimisation, or denial of promotion, facilities or training opportunities. Almost all workers in the public, private, and voluntary sectors including contractors are protected under this Act. Certain types of disclosures as listed below qualify for protection if they are made in good faith and it is reasonable to believe that the misconduct was occurring now, happened in the past or will likely happen in the future.

  • A criminal offence
  • Failure to comply with legal obligations
  • A miscarriage of justice
  • Danger to health or safety of any individual
  • Damage to the environment
  • Attempt to cover up information that would provide evidence that any of these five practices occurred
